2. The Democratization of Investing Through Technology

Fintech Is Breaking Down Barriers

Gone are the days when investing was reserved for the wealthy elite. With the advent of fintech platforms, investing is now accessible, affordable, and automated.

  • Robo-Advisors: Tools like Wealthfront and Betterment use algorithms to manage your portfolio with low fees and optimized tax strategies.
  • Fractional Shares: Apps like Robinhood, Public, and SoFi allow you to invest in top-performing stocks with as little as $1.
  • Social Investing: Platforms like eToro enable users to follow and copy the investment strategies of successful traders.

5. The Rise of Alternative Investments

Diversification in a New Era

Stocks and bonds aren’t the only game in town anymore. Savvy investors are turning to alternative assets like:

  • Real Estate Crowdfunding (e.g., Fundrise, RealtyMogul)
  • Private Equity and Venture Capital
  • Art and Collectibles (e.g., Masterworks)
  • Peer-to-Peer Lending
  • Wine, Watches, and Rare Items

These alternatives offer diversification and potential higher returns while often being uncorrelated with the stock market.
